Penn Modifies Lia Thomas Records, Apologizes to Female Athletes

The University of Pennsylvania has agreed to a settlement with the U.S. Education Department, modifying three school swimming records set by transgender swimmer Lia Thomas. The department investigated Penn for violating the rights of female athletes, concluding the university's policies disadvantaged them. As part of the settlement, Penn will restore records to female athletes who lost to Thomas, issue apologies, and adopt a biology-based definition of sex for athletic participation. The agreement follows the NCAA's updated policy limiting transgender women's participation in women's sports. Education Secretary Linda McMahon hailed the settlement as a victory for women and girls.
